MacLennan Editors Ahmet Tuncay Turgut - Anastasia Canacci Associate Editors Mehmet Ruhi Onur Assistant Editor Genitourinary Radiology: Kidney, … Web7 apr. 2024 · To find the adjoint of a matrix, you simply have to swap elements a11 with a22 and switch the signs of elements a12 and a21 from positive to negative or vice versa. Adjoint matrix of 3 X 3 To find the adjoint of a 3x3 matrix, you will have to find the cofactors of each element. After finding the cofactors, arrange them in a matrix.
